Advertisement
Guest User

Untitled

a guest
Jul 16th, 2012
110
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.69 KB | None | 0 0
  1. /* processor status */
  2. enum {
  3. PSW_IE = (1<<0),
  4. PSW_EIE = (1<<1),
  5. PSW_BIE = (1<<2),
  6. PSW_ITLB = (1<<4),
  7. PSW_EITLB = (1<<5),
  8. PSW_BITLB = (1<<6),
  9. PSW_DTLB = (1<<7),
  10. PSW_EDTLB = (1<<8),
  11. PSW_BDTLB = (1<<9),
  12. PSW_USR = (1<<10),
  13. PSW_EUSR = (1<<11),
  14. PSW_BUSR = (1<<12),
  15. };
  16.  
  17.  
  18. /* TLBCTRL commands */
  19. enum {
  20. ITLB_FLUSH = 0x02,
  21. DTLB_FLUSH = 0x03,
  22. ITLB_UPDATE = 0x04,
  23. DTLB_UPDATE = 0x05,
  24. ITLB_INVALIDATE = 0x20,
  25. DTLB_INVALIDATE = 0x21,
  26. };
  27.  
  28. /* CSRs */
  29. enum {
  30. ...
  31. CSR_PSW = 0x1c,
  32. CSR_TLBCTRL = 0x1d,
  33. CSR_TLBVADDR = 0x1e,
  34. CSR_TLBPADDR = 0x1f,
  35. };
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ement